Hey Pete! I got an email from your forum, and I figured it was to check on whether I was still interested in the forum. My old login still works, so here I am. Just went through a complete top-end rebuild and General clean-up of the Interceptor. brand new cylinders, pistons, heads refurbished from the valve seats out, new concentric Amals ( I don’t know why I avoided buying those for so long, they’re so much better than the old monoblocks), and I’m pretty psyched about getting back on the road with it. All the parts came from Hitchcock’s. This will be the first time since it was new that it’s had standard bore pistons in it. When I bought it, it had clapped out .020 over pistons in it. I’m waiting on a local shop to finish rebuilding the Suzuki GT 750 “teakettle” front calipers, and it’ll be on the road.2 points
